The most potent weapons strike with such power that they make a mockery of armour and can cleave through several foes.
Each time an attack made with a [DEVASTATING WOUNDS] weapon results in a critical wound, the attack sequence for that attack ends and the target unit suffers a number of mortal wounds equal to the D characteristic of that weapon. These are inflicted after resolving any normal damage inflicted by those attacks.

Many deadly weapons can inflict fatal injuries on any foe, no matter their resilience.
Each time an attack made with a [LETHAL HITS] weapon results in a critical hit, you can choose for that attack to automatically wound the target.
